What to Check Before Registration

A credible casino should identify the operating company, regulatory framework, and applicable terms before asking for personal information. Look for a visible licence reference, responsible-gambling information, privacy documentation, and a clear explanation of verification procedures. These details do not guarantee a perfect experience, but their absence is a meaningful warning sign.

Geographical availability is equally important. A website may be accessible from a particular country while not being authorised to accept residents there. Players should confirm local eligibility, age requirements, and tax obligations independently. Using a virtual location to bypass restrictions can lead to suspended withdrawals or account closure.

  • Confirm the operator’s legal name and licensing information.
  • Check whether your country and preferred currency are supported.
  • Read withdrawal, identity-verification, and dormant-account clauses.
  • Review the privacy policy before submitting documents.

Games, Software, and Mobile Performance

Game variety matters, but catalogue size alone is a weak quality indicator. A stronger review examines whether titles come from recognisable studios, display rules clearly, and use independently tested random number generation where required. Slots, live dealer tables, table games, and jackpot products should be separated logically so that visitors can find suitable options without excessive filtering.

Mobile performance is now part of the core product. A useful interface should load efficiently on ordinary connections, preserve betting controls on smaller screens, and display balance information without ambiguity. Players should also test whether the cashier, game history, help centre, and account settings work smoothly on both mobile and desktop devices before depositing substantial funds.

Bonuses and the Real Cost of Promotions

Promotional offers should be assessed as contracts rather than advertising headlines. A welcome bonus may include a deposit match, free spins, or cashback, but its actual value depends on wagering requirements, eligible games, maximum bet limits, expiry periods, and withdrawal caps. The headline percentage is rarely the most important figure.

Before accepting an offer, calculate the required turnover and identify which bets contribute fully or partially. A high wagering multiplier can make a bonus unattractive even when the initial reward appears generous. Players should also check whether a promotion is automatically applied, whether bonus funds expire separately from deposits, and whether restricted payment methods affect eligibility.

The safest practice is to treat promotional money as optional entertainment value, never as income. Depositing only to unlock a reward can encourage larger stakes and weaken budget control, particularly when the terms are difficult to interpret.

Payments, Verification, and Withdrawals

Banking quality is measured by predictability, not by the number of logos shown on a cashier page. Compare minimum and maximum limits, processing stages, fees, currency conversion, and the difference between operator approval and final bank delivery. A withdrawal listed as “instant” may still require manual review or identity checks.

Verification requests are normal in regulated gambling. Operators may ask for an identity document, proof of address, payment ownership, or source-of-funds information. Submit documents only through the protected account area, ensure that images are readable, and avoid sending sensitive files to unverified email addresses. Do not make additional deposits solely to resolve a pending withdrawal unless the operator’s official terms clearly require it and support confirms the reason in writing.

Budget Control and Final Assessment

A responsible playing plan begins with a fixed entertainment budget, a time limit, and a decision to stop when either limit is reached. Losses should not be chased, and gambling should never replace essential spending. Use deposit limits, cooling-off periods, session reminders, or self-exclusion tools whenever available. If gambling becomes difficult to control, contact a recognised support organisation in your jurisdiction.
